- Anthem: God of Mercy – Healey Willan (based on the tune Heathlands by Henry Smart)
God of mercy, God of grace, Show the brightness of Thy face:
Shine upon us, Saviour, shine, Fill Thy church with light divine;
And Thy saving health extend Unto earth’s remotest end.
Let the people praise Thee, Lord;Be by all that live adored:
Let the nations shout and sing,Glory to their Saviour King;
At Thy feet their tribute pay,And Thy holy will obey.
Let the people praise Thee, Lord;Earth shall then her fruits afford;
God to man His blessing give,Man to God devoted live;
All below, and all above,One in joy, and light, and love.
- Words by Henry Francis Lyte (1793-1847)
